Lumpin Croop is a Halfling Mercenary Captain who leads Lumpin Croop's Fighting Cocks. [1]

Appaeance

He has bright orange hair. [1]

History

Lumpin was born in northern Moot, his father a itinerant carrot salesma and his mother the daughter of a blacksmith although his father died choking to death on a horseshoe before he was born. His grandparents disliked him as a reminder of their child's unwise liasion and as soon as he was able he ran away from home. [1]

Having already become skilled at pick-pocketing he became a poacher much to the annoyance of local gamekeepers. One day whilst visiting the Old Pig and Bucket in the village of Beggar's Ford he found himself face to face with a group of cudgel armed gamekeepers. He managed to spin them a tale of excitement, treasure and most important banquets that were for the taking over the mountains in Tilea and after many drinks - Lumpin Croop's Fighting Cocks were born. [2]

Since then he has been trying to give his companions the slip but as they are all skilled woodsmen, they have always caught up with on what he subsequently describes as Training Exercises. As excellent archers and scouts, there services have become much in demand. [1]
